Output 68a1e807342d93d8e173b026c452149e433e14ef62e02c35d794cfe6a186d62e:0

value
26943
script pubkey
OP_0 OP_PUSHBYTES_20 a0590dd9d67d1498e99184d5eb9bf0da07e22838
address
bc1q5pvsmkwk052f36v3sn27hxlsmgr7y2pckaht4f
transaction
68a1e807342d93d8e173b026c452149e433e14ef62e02c35d794cfe6a186d62e
confirmations
180499
spent
true